19.12.2012 Views

lt tDrtrcnr or Eleiro.ics, Td@6o!!iolio, & ttior.di.rl E.linerttrg

lt tDrtrcnr or Eleiro.ics, Td@6o!!iolio, & ttior.di.rl E.linerttrg

lt tDrtrcnr or Eleiro.ics, Td@6o!!iolio, & ttior.di.rl E.linerttrg

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

(j;),'l<br />

r 4r''r,r. tii!,l<strong>rl</strong>r!4 '(')-.n<strong>rl</strong>. rr!''<strong>rl</strong> i,J ',r,r<br />

wbere i is the itcraion numb€r. dd ,r- b. valne thnl $al4 rhc hist<strong>or</strong>ical congestion<br />

Fna<strong>lt</strong>t. Tn€ hisr<strong>or</strong>iel conSe$ioo Fnahy is updated afier *h rouling ircradon.<br />

Thc values of/rs and tr& @opris wbal is c,lled $c Dutirg J.r..rul.. Noml<strong>lt</strong>, the<br />

llliu<strong>lt</strong> b,tikt lchulub ol vPl{ is usd. whcrc rhc vrhrc tur/)ri. is sur ro 0.5 <strong>or</strong> lcss i[<br />

rh€ fid i{€ntion and incr.sed by 1.5 b 2 tin6 in sub*qn€nl ileElions. Thc volue ol<br />

,rd is sel ro my value b€rween 0.2 and l. md remains consani in subs.quefl n.nrions<br />

Witl $e defallr ouliDS $hedule, VPR uually rcquiBs sleral ileratiotrs lo oute a<br />

circuir. The out.r can be speed up by lm lo th@ rincs by s<strong>lt</strong>ing pr* dd ,r- lo 10000.<br />

callcd dE /dr, ,<strong>or</strong>/,,9 .$r4tlllG. The f6t @uliog eh.dule f<strong>or</strong>ccs lhe rcut$ lo aloid oveF<br />

usilr8 routins lcsoures il po$ibh, esu<strong>lt</strong>ing in a lcducrion irr lhe number ol outins<br />

nmions. F<strong>or</strong> .6y Doblcms, thc routcr can smeliDcs rcurc the circun in jut one<br />

ncration. The fastrouri<strong>rl</strong>g sclEdule lypically dquircs only 2% b 4% nolc lracks ovef llre<br />

b6r uock couDr f<strong>or</strong> a circuit by VPR.<br />

Anoth.r impon.nl .nhanceme.l in VPR !.Fu Palh,lntler is thc nann r h which rhe<br />

muti.8 tee is placed back on rhc pio'iry queue when duting a mullit€rninal ner'<br />

RmcNb.r lhal |he P!$lloder als<strong>or</strong>ithm cdptiB $e PQ aner och sint is rc&hcd in a<br />

nnrhi-ominal net, and puts lbe conplete RT back on 6e PQ Ge lnE ?) F<strong>or</strong> vcrv hrgh_<br />

idout ne$, $c RT is very lsrse, Equning signitcml CPU timc simPly lo placc lhc R-r<br />

o. rhe PQ f<strong>or</strong> each sink, vPR conlaihs a n@h n<strong>or</strong>e elfrciem n.lhod. called $e<br />

qthitc.l hftd.ih-li{t vuch. *heto rhe PQ G len it ns cuntrn slate aiDr ieachirrs n<br />

(t.6)<br />

ll

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!